Razer has launched a new gaming mouse, the Razer Salmosa.
This new mouse is reported to be the quickest entry-level gaming mouse and apparently has the World’s fastest tracking optical sensor.
Key Features and Specifications
Here’s the specs:
- 1800dpi Razer Precision 3G infrared sensor
- 1000Hz Ultrapolling / 1ms response time
- Mechanical dpi/polling rate switches
- On-The-Fly Sensitivity adjustment
- Always-On mode
- Ultra-large non-slip buttons
- 16-bit ultra-wide data path
- 60-120 inches per second
- Three independently programmable Hyperesponse buttons
- Ambidextrous design
- Scroll wheel with 24 individual click positions
- Zero-acoustic Ultraslick Teflon feet
- Seven-foot, lightweight, non-tangle cord
- Approximate size: 115mm x 63mm x 37mm
Enhanced Gaming Experience
The Razer Salmosa is designed to cater to both novice and experienced gamers. Its 1800dpi Razer Precision 3G infrared sensor ensures that every movement is tracked with pinpoint accuracy, making it ideal for fast-paced gaming scenarios. The 1000Hz Ultrapolling feature, coupled with a 1ms response time, means that the mouse communicates with your computer 1000 times per second, ensuring that there is no lag between your actions and what happens on the screen.
The mechanical dpi/polling rate switches allow gamers to adjust the sensitivity and polling rate on the fly, providing a customizable experience that can be tailored to different gaming genres or personal preferences. This feature is particularly useful in games that require quick reflexes and precise movements, such as first-person shooters or real-time strategy games.
The always-on mode ensures that the mouse is ready to go as soon as you are, eliminating the need for any warm-up time. The ultra-large non-slip buttons are designed to provide a comfortable and secure grip, even during extended gaming sessions. This is complemented by the ambidextrous design, making the Razer Salmosa suitable for both left and right-handed users.
The scroll wheel with 24 individual click positions offers precise control, which is essential for tasks that require fine adjustments, such as selecting weapons or navigating through menus. The zero-acoustic Ultraslick Teflon feet ensure that the mouse glides smoothly across any surface, providing a seamless gaming experience.
The seven-foot, lightweight, non-tangle cord gives you the freedom to move without being restricted by cable length or tangles. This is particularly beneficial for gamers who prefer a larger play area or those who participate in LAN parties and need the extra length to connect to distant computers.
